The 1.0.1 update for Naruto x Boruto: Ultimate Ninja Storm Connections was a small but necessary step in the game's post-launch support. While its official notes are minor, it ensured all players began their journey with a stable and inclusive foundation, ready for the massive content and critical gameplay balance that would come in later updates.
